Transaction ed24cba5e85af1eae8accf83a14c14a0f0886933ea4d0caac53122f3697e5bc8
1 Input
1 Output
-
ed24cba5e85af1eae8accf83a14c14a0f0886933ea4d0caac53122f3697e5bc8:0
- value
- 18188
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b6995d02aa69d30aecb9830ff8a75179f7920e5
- address
- bc1q3d5et5p256wnptktnqc0lzn4z70hjg89u9dmjd